About A. Sadovski

A. Sadovski is a scholar working on Geology, Media Technology and Radiation, having authored 8 papers that have together received 15 indexed citations. Recurring topics across this work include Experimental Learning in Engineering (1 paper), Energy Load and Power Forecasting (1 paper) and Medical Imaging Techniques and Applications (1 paper). The work is most often cited by research in Architecture (1 citation), Radiation (4 citations) and Nuclear and High Energy Physics (5 citations). A. Sadovski has collaborated with scholars based in United States, Russia and France. Frequent co-authors include A. Nozdrin, M. Dracos, A. G. Olchevski, B. Grynyov, Oleksandr Melnychuk, Y. Gornushkin, U. Moser, P. Vilain, F. Juget and J.E. Campagne. Their work appears in journals such as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ment, Radiation Measurements and Papers on Engineering Education Repository (American Society for Engineering Education).
